Ziel der Reise / Objectives of Cruise:

As part of the bachelor's degree program in geophysics/oceanography at the university of Hamburg, a 'Berufs- und Seepraktikum' (internship) is carried out. The students are enabled to prepare a measuring cruise scientifically and logistically, to carry it out, to evaluate the data obtained and to communicate the results in presentations and in a report. The preparation takes place within a seminar, in which the students prepare presentations including handouts about the scientific objectives, measurement techniques used and data processing procedures. The area of interest in 2021 was a part of the North Frisian coast, centered around the island of Amrum and encompassed by the islands Sylt and Fohr, as well as the Halligen and shoals like Japsand to the south. The intent of the student excursion was to investigate the short term variability of oceanographic parameters like temperature, salinity and currents. Essentially, CTD and ADCP measurements were performed. At 3 positions, additional moorings were laid out for approx. 1 week.
